Buttered Haricots Verts

3.8

(7)

(Buttered Thin French Green Beans)

Can be prepared in 45 minutes or less.

Recipe information

  • Yield

    Serves 8

Ingredients

1 pound haricots verts (thin French green beans, available at specialty produce markets and some supermarkets)
2 tablespoons unsalted butter

Preparation

  1. In a kettle of boiling salted water boil the haricots verts for 4 to 6 minutes, or until they are crisp-tender, drain them, and plunge them into a bowl of ice and cold water to stop the cooking. Drain the beans again and pat them dry. The beans may be prepared up to this point 1 day in advance and kept wrapped in dampened paper towels in a plastic bag and chilled. Just before serving, in a large skillet melt the butter over moderately high heat and in it toss the haricots verts until they are heated through. Season the haricots verts with salt and pepper.
